Transaction 58b534fe2d1d2dfd8a5a798f84b676725ae0b320921ce032b7abdff82febbb63
2 Input
2 Outputs
- 58b534fe2d1d2dfd8a5a798f84b676725ae0b320921ce032b7abdff82febbb63:0
- 58b534fe2d1d2dfd8a5a798f84b676725ae0b320921ce032b7abdff82febbb63:1
value 3105
address 1KCwAPH6a8rpxnKr1M6VtiAegi4ekvbTAS
value 2326736
address 13TKxD3hzwuAjaR9oGsas4dseXCdLWpuat